Adaptive Learning Software Market is Projected to Hit US$ 10,887.0 Million by 2032
The market for adaptive learning software is anticipated to experience substantial growth worldwide, particularly in countries such as China, India, and Brazil, as well as the United States. This growth is largely driven by students’ increasing preference for remote learning options, especially in executive education programs.
New Delhi, Feb. 06, 2025 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) — As detailed in the latest research from Astute Analytica, the global adaptive learning software market is poised for substantial growth, with revenue estimated to increase from US$ 2,063.1 million in 2023 to US$ 10,887.0 million by 2032, at a CAGR of 20.3% during the forecast period of 2024–2032.
The shift towards remote and hybrid learning models has opened up vast opportunities for the integration of adaptive learning software in educational settings. As traditional classroom environments are transformed, this software addresses the increasing need for structured yet flexible learning paths that students can navigate independently. With the ability to learn at their own pace and tailor their education to fit their unique circumstances, students can continue their studies seamlessly, regardless of location. This shift not only makes education more accessible but also promotes a more inclusive learning experience, catering to a diverse range of learners.

Research conducted by Raccoon Gang highlights the significant impact that adaptive learning platforms have on student performance and engagement. These platforms are designed to personalize the educational experience, ensuring they receive the support they need to thrive academically. For instance, Knewton, a prominent player in the adaptive learning space, reported a remarkable 23% increase in learning outcomes among students utilizing their adaptive platform. This statistic underscores the effectiveness of adaptive learning technologies in fostering improved academic results, demonstrating that personalized learning can lead to meaningful advancements in student achievement.
Similarly, DreamBox Learning has provided compelling evidence of the benefits of adaptive learning in mathematics education. Their research indicates that students who engage with their adaptive math program for at least 60 minutes per week experience a 59% higher growth in math proficiency compared to their peers who do not use the program. This statistic not only reflects the power of adaptive learning software in enhancing subject-specific skills but also illustrates its potential to close learning gaps and boost overall student confidence in their abilities. As more educational institutions adopt these innovative solutions, the landscape of learning continues to evolve, creating a future where personalized education becomes the norm rather than the exception.
Increasing Personalization in Education: Transforming Adaptive Learning Software
Personalized education is rapidly becoming a cornerstone of modern learning, reflecting the unique needs and preferences of each student. In this evolving educational landscape, adaptive learning software has emerged as a powerful tool designed to meet these diverse needs effectively. This innovative technology allows students to learn at their own pace and according to their individual terms, creating a more engaging and effective learning experience. By leveraging algorithms and data analytics, adaptive learning software analyzes each student’s learning behavior, strengths, and areas for improvement. This capability enables the software to dynamically adjust the content and difficulty level based on the student’s progress, ensuring that the educational material is both relevant and challenging.
As a result of these advancements, schools and educational institutions are increasingly recognizing the potential of adaptive learning software to enhance educational outcomes. By incorporating this technology into their curriculums, educators can provide a more tailored approach to learning that accommodates the varied abilities and learning styles of their students. This personalized approach not only helps in improving academic performance but also plays a critical role in reducing dropout rates. When students receive instruction that aligns with their individual learning needs, they are more likely to remain engaged and motivated throughout their educational journey.
Moreover, adaptive learning software equips educators with valuable insights into each student’s progress. With the ability to track learning outcomes in real time, teachers can identify when a student is struggling or excelling, allowing them to offer targeted support where necessary. This data-driven approach enhances the teaching process, enabling educators to make informed decisions that benefit their students.
Additionally, the rise of e-learning platforms and online education has further accelerated the trend towards personalized learning. These platforms make adaptive learning solutions accessible to a broader audience, breaking down geographical barriers and providing students with the opportunity to engage in customized learning experiences from anywhere in the world. As the demand for personalized education continues to grow, adaptive learning software is set to play an increasingly vital role in shaping the future of education.
Large Enterprises Hold More Than 50% of Revenue Share
The large enterprise segment currently commands a significant portion of the market, holding a 75% share. This impressive dominance can be primarily attributed to the substantial resources that large enterprises possess, which enable them to make significant investments in advanced learning technologies. These organizations typically have the financial capability to implement comprehensive training programs that leverage state-of-the-art tools and platforms, ensuring that their workforce is well-equipped to meet the demands of a rapidly changing business environment.
One of the key factors contributing to the strong position of large enterprises in this sector is their diverse and geographically dispersed workforce. With employees spread across different locations and often operating in various roles, large organizations face unique challenges in delivering consistent and effective training. This complexity creates a pressing need for adaptive learning solutions that accommodate a wide range of learning styles and needs, allowing for a more personalized approach to employee development.
Furthermore, the ability of large enterprises to invest in adaptive learning solutions facilitates the development of tailored training experiences that enhance overall workforce productivity. These organizations can analyze performance data and feedback to continuously improve their training offerings, addressing skill gaps and adapting to the evolving landscape of business needs.
As a result, large enterprises are not only able to maintain their competitive edge but also cultivate a culture of continuous learning and professional growth among their employees. This strategic approach to employee development underscores the importance of adaptive learning technologies in driving organizational success, further solidifying the dominance of the large enterprise segment in the market.
Corporates are Adopting Adaptive Learning Software
The corporate segment within the education technology market is projected to experience the highest comp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 21.6%. This significant growth can be largely attributed to the increasing demand for personalized and flexible learning solutions that extend beyond traditional educational institutions. As organizations strive to enhance employee skills and knowledge, they are increasingly turning to adaptive learning software. This technology allows companies to provide tailored learning experiences that cater to the unique needs of their workforce, ultimately improving teaching effectiveness and fostering a more engaged learning environment.
In addition to corporate adoption, the segment’s growth is also influenced by the rising trend of homeschooling. More families are opting for homeschooling as an alternative to conventional schooling, leading to a growing number of students seeking additional academic support outside the classroom. This shift is prompting parents to explore various educational resources, including private tutoring services that utilize advanced technologies. As the education landscape becomes more competitive, parents and students are increasingly turning to private tutors who employ adaptive learning software to gain a competitive edge.
These tutors can offer personalized instruction that addresses individual learning styles and paces, making the learning process more effective.
The convenience and effectiveness of adaptive learning solutions are expected to continue driving their adoption among private tutors in the coming years. As these technologies become more accessible and user-friendly, they are likely to be integrated into tutoring practices more widely.
This trend reflects a broader recognition of the value of personalized learning experiences, not only in corporate training but also in supplementary education for students. As organizations and educators alike embrace these innovative tools, the corporate segment is poised for substantial growth, reshaping the future of learning in both professional and academic settings.
